In the walled city state of Aramanth rules are everything When Kestrel Hath dares to rebel the Chief Examiner humiliates her father & sentences the whole family to the harshest punishment Desperate to save them Kestrel learns the secret of the wind singer & she & her twin brother Bowman set out on a terrifying journey to the true source of evil that grips Aramanth ' In terms of imagination & sheer scale it's as ambitious as books get think Star Wars & then some'
